
비스듬한, 기울어진, 사선의
Neither parallel nor at a right angle to a specified or implied line; slanting.
예문:
"The sunlight entered the room at an oblique angle, illuminating the dust motes."
"The architect designed an oblique roof to prevent snow accumulation."
완곡한, 간접적인, 에두른
Not explicit or direct in addressing a point; expressed indirectly.
예문:
"She made an oblique reference to her previous employer during the interview."
"His oblique criticism was lost on those who didn't know the full story."
사격의
Denoting any grammatical case other than the nominative or vocative.
예문:
"In some languages, the oblique case is used for all objects of prepositions."
"The pronoun changes its form when it moves from the direct to an oblique case."
사선, 슬래시
A slanting line (/) used in writing and printing; a slash.
예문:
"Please separate the alternative options with an oblique in the form."
"The date was written with obliques between the day, month, and year."
사근, 옆구리근
Any of several muscles that are oriented at an angle, especially those in the abdominal wall.
예문:
"Side planks are an excellent exercise for strengthening your internal obliques."
"He strained an oblique muscle while twisting to catch the ball."
경사지다, 기울다
To move or be oriented in a slanting direction, especially in military formation.
예문:
"The unit was ordered to oblique to the left to avoid the marshy ground."
"The road began to oblique sharply toward the coastline."
